<p>I see this is a really old post. The &quot;How Sweet It Is&quot; is what Jackie Gleason (Brooklyn Native) used to say. That was his trademark phrase! His hit comedy the Honeymooners supposedly took place in Bensonhurst, Brooklyn.</p>
